Understanding the Core Principles of Strategic Risk

At the heart of any effective strategy incorporating fortune play lies a deep understanding of risk assessment. This isn’t about eliminating risk – that's often impossible – but about quantifying it, categorizing it, and developing mitigation strategies. The first step involves identifying all potential risks associated with a particular action or venture. These risks can be financial, operational, reputational, or even personal. Once identified, each risk needs to be analyzed in terms of its probability of occurrence and the potential magnitude of its impact. A high-probability, high-impact risk demands immediate attention and proactive measures, while a low-probability, low-impact risk might be deemed acceptable. This process is not a one-time exercise; it requires continual monitoring and reevaluation as circumstances change.

The Role of Diversification in Mitigating Risk

Diversification is a cornerstone of risk management and a vital component of successful fortune play. By spreading investments or efforts across a range of different options, individuals and organizations can reduce their exposure to any single point of failure. This principle applies not only to financial investments but also to strategic initiatives. For example, a company might diversify its product line, its geographic markets, or its supply chain to reduce its dependence on any one factor. A well-diversified approach minimizes the potential for catastrophic loss and increases the likelihood of achieving consistent, long-term gains. It allows for setbacks in one area to be offset by successes in another.

Frameworks for Evaluating Potential Investments

Various frameworks can assist in evaluating potential investments and making informed decisions. One common approach is cost-benefit analysis, which involves weighing the potential benefits of a project against its associated costs. Another useful tool is scenario planning, which involves developing multiple plausible scenarios for the future and assessing the potential impact of each scenario on the investment. Sensitivity analysis can also be used to determine how changes in key variables, such as interest rates or market demand, would affect the profitability of the investment. Ultimately, the decision to invest should be based on a comprehensive analysis of all relevant factors, and a clear understanding of the risks and rewards involved.
